How to Balance Work and Uterine Cancer Treatment Dealing with uterine cancer treatment while maintaining work can be tough but many people find ways to manage it. It’s important to look for support where you can especially when juggling job duties and health care needs. Good communication with your employer and co-workers about your situation is helpful. They might offer flexible hours or remote work opportunities that fit your treatment schedule better. Always remember that taking care of health should come first.Managing responsibilities at work during uterine cancer treatment requires a thoughtful approach to planning the day. Setting clear priorities helps in focusing on tasks that need urgent attention while keeping stress levels low. Sharing workload with colleagues could also lighten the load allowing more time for rest and recovery after treatments or appointments are done.

Workplace support plays a vital role in balancing job demands with medical care requirements effectively. Employers often have policies in place designed to assist employees going through health challenges like cancer treatments. Always check what options are available within the company policy guidelines before making any decisions about work plans going forward.

Creating a Supportive Work Environment

When balancing work with uterine cancer treatment talking to your employer is key. Be open about your situation and the support you need. It’s okay to ask for help in managing responsibilities. Your employer may suggest changes that can make work easier during this time.

It helps to outline what workplace support might look like for you personally. Maybe it’s flexible hours or a place to rest at work. Talk about how these changes help maintain your health and job performance both. Such conversations show proactive thinking and often lead employers to be accommodating.

Your colleagues can also provide valuable support as you balance treatment with work demands. Let them know what you’re going through but keep it simple if that feels best for you right now. They may offer help without being asked which shows they care and want to assist however they can. Creating an action plan with HR could also be beneficial as part of workplace support efforts during this period. This ensures everyone knows their roles clearly.

Managing Responsibilities

When undergoing uterine cancer treatment it’s crucial to prioritize tasks at work. Think about what must be done now and what can wait. This helps you focus on important things without getting overwhelmed. Share your task list with your manager for better time management.

Delegating is another strategy that works well during this period. Identify tasks others can handle and explain them clearly when handing them off. Trusting colleagues with responsibilities shows confidence in their abilities. It also allows you more space to balance work and treatments.

Time management becomes even more essential while balancing work with health needs. Break down projects into smaller steps that are manageable given your energy levels each day. This will help reduce stress overall. Use tools like calendars or apps if they help keep track of deadlines easily.

Self-Care Practices

Self-care is vital when balancing work and uterine cancer treatment. It’s important to find time for relaxation even if it’s just a few minutes daily. Activities like reading or listening to music can calm your mind. Remember taking short breaks throughout the day aids in maintaining well-being.

Incorporating physical activity into your routine also supports self-care. Gentle exercises such as walking or yoga can boost energy levels and reduce stress. Always listen to your body though and only do what feels comfortable during this time; never push too hard!

Seeking Flexibility in Work Arrangements

Flexible work arrangements are key when undergoing uterine cancer treatment. They allow you to manage your health while keeping up with job tasks. Talk to your employer about the possibility of adjusting your work hours or location. Be clear about how this flexibility can help maintain productivity despite medical appointments and recovery times.

Negotiation is an important part of securing accommodations at work. When discussing options present a well-thought-out plan that shows how you can still meet job responsibilities. Remember it’s a two-way conversation; be open to suggestions from your employer.

Frequently Asked Questions

How can I talk to my employer about needing time off for treatment?

Start by scheduling a private meeting with your manager. Explain your situation clearly and discuss how much time you might need off. Offer solutions like working remotely if possible.

What should I do if my workload is too heavy during my treatment?

Be honest with your supervisor about what you can handle. Ask if tasks can be reassigned or deadlines extended considering the circumstances of uterine cancer treatment.

Can I ask for workplace accommodations without disclosing all my medical details?

Yes you're not required to share all medical information. Just provide enough detail so that HR understands why accommodations like flexible work hours are necessary.
